Triple X:
I just sold a CP Gullwing (same hull as your TX-19). For comparison, at 5200 rpm, mine would run 82.3 mph on GPS. This was with about 475 HP, a Dominator 12-S with an A/B impeller, flowed bowl, ride plate, back-cut shoe, droop, and diverter.

My Youngblood which is what a TX19 was splashed from runs 82-83 @5200 /w a MPD preped pump with a SS B impeller. I also run a MPD ride plate & shoe. I doubt I have any more HP than you. I have a 427. I think you are about 20 mph from where you should be if your motor is running right.

MPD magic is a wonderful thing. Jack did the original pump build on my CP Gullwing, as well as doing some additional high-po work after the inital installation. He knows how to set up pumps, and Bill Scotten knows how to build hulls. I'll give as much detail as I can, but there is no substitute for calling Jack and talking to him firsthand. Mine was a Dominator 12S - with an MPD prepped A/B impeller (3 grooves cut into the wear ring mating surface). The bowl was the factory Dominator unit, with a flow job by Jack. The intake was a stock unit, machined for a ride plate and shoe by Jack. The shoe was a 5/8" 2 degree back cut shoe by Jack, and a 0.060" shim (by me). It had an open center "river racer" loader by Jack. The biting edge of the shoe was set up about 0.060" above the keel line. The ride plate was 4 degrees up. The Aggressor droop snoot was wedged down 4 degrees, and it had a standard size manual control place diverter.
My engine was pretty mild (about 475 hp, with thru-transom exhaust), but did have aluminum heads and intake, which shaved about 100 pounds off the back of the boat. This was not a race boat by any means, but just a quick family boat, which ran a best speed of 82.6 mph at 5200 rpm in a slight chop at Lake Of The Ozarks.
